The Art and Science of Coin Accumulating: Exploring Numismatics
Numismatics, the study and assortment of currency, presents fanatics a novel mix of historical exploration, aesthetic appreciation, and monetary investment. Beyond the mere accumulation of shiny objects, coin collecting delves into civilizations previous and present, offering a window into their economies, cultures, and even political landscapes.
The Historical Tapestry of Coins
Coins are miniature marvels that encapsulate the ethos of their time. Every minting bears the imprint of the period it was struck, reflecting the values, aspirations, and infrequently the political ideologies of the issuing authority. Whether it's the noble profiles of historical rulers, the intricate designs of medieval guilds, or the nationalistic symbols of modern nations, coins serve as tangible artifacts of human history.
Take, as an illustration, the Roman denarius, a silver coin that circulated for centuries throughout the huge empire. Its evolving imagery tells a story of shifting energy dynamics, from the early republic to the autocratic rule of emperors. Equally, the European Renaissance witnessed a resurgence in artistic expression, mirrored within the intricately engraved coins of the interval, showcasing the talents of master craftsmen.

The Science Behind the Interest
Past the surface allure lies the scientific underpinnings of numismatics. Collectors delve into the trivia of minting strategies, metallurgy, and even counterfeit detection to authenticate and evaluate coins. Advanced applied sciences, comparable to X-ray fluorescence spectroscopy and high-decision imaging, aid in the evaluation of composition, wear patterns, and surface anomalies, providing valuable insights right into a coin's provenance and authenticity.
Additionalmore, numismatics intersects with disciplines akin to archaeology, economics, and sociology, providing a multidimensional approach to understanding human civilization. Coins serve as primary sources for historians, shedding light on trade routes, financial policies, and societal hierarchies of bygone eras. They offer a tangible link to the past, enriching our understanding of historic cultures and their interactions.
